Phase-field simulation of strain-induced ferroelectric domain evolution in hexagonal manganites

چکیده انگلیسی
The domain structures evolution induced by strain in hexagonal manganites was simulated through using phase-field simulation. The result demonstrated that tensile strain in x direction (or compressive strain in y direction) and pure shear strain will drive topological ferroelectric vortex into topological stripe domains in y direction and x direction, respectively. During this ferroelectric domain evolution, the annihilation of topological vortex-antivortex was found in a way that vortices and antivortices are moving in the opposite direction. Meanwhile, the topological charge is conservative during this evolution under the periodic boundary condition.
